FORTEVIA is a minimalist two-player print-and-play strategy game where every symbol marks the advance of your territory. One player uses triangles, the other uses squares. Starting from opposite sides of a symmetrical grid, players expand one space at a time, building paths, blocking routes, and advancing toward the enemy Fortress. There are no pieces to move: the symbols drawn on the grid are your territory, your army, and the record of the entire match. When a player tries to conquer a space occupied by the opponent, both roll a six-sided die. The higher result controls the space. A successful attack replaces the enemy symbol with your own, while a failed attack leaves the position unchanged. The objective is simple: reach and capture the opponent’s Fortress, represented by their first circled symbol. FORTEVIA is designed to be quick to learn, easy to print, and playable almost anywhere. All you need is a sheet of paper, a pencil, and a d6.

How many players can play?
FORTEVIA is exclusively for two players.
How long does a game last?
A game lasts between 5 and 10 minutes.
Do you need many components?
No! You only need paper, a pencil, and a six-sided die.
Is it hard to learn?
No, the rules are simple and the game is easy to understand.
Can you play it anywhere?
Yes, it’s portable and can be played anywhere with space for a sheet of paper.
